We now have our first look at Amazon’s The Lord of the Rings television series. The series is a a prequel to both The Hobbit and Lord of the Rings; with the events taking place thousands of years before the events of those books. The series is headed by showrunners/exec producers J.D. Payne and Patrick McKay with film-maker J.A. Bayona directing the first two episodes and serving as executive producer, alongside his creative partner Belén Atienza; with executive producers Lindsey Weber, Bruce Richmond, Callum Greene, Gennifer Hutchison, Jason Cahill, Justin Doble and Sharon Tal Yguado. It will be released exclusively on Amazon Prime.

Sir Lenny Henry joins cast for Amazon’s ‘Lord Of The Rings’ TV series
Amazon Studios has today officially announced twenty additional cast members joining the Amazon Original series based on The Lord of the Rings novels. The newly revealed cast members will join the previously announced global cast and crew, currently filming in New Zealand. Notable additions include British comic legend Sir Lenny Henry. Doctor Who Showrunner Teases Season 12 Episode Structure And Returning Foes
After Season 11 standalone stories, Doctor Who is bringing back its trademark two-part episodes.
RadioTimes.com has learned the upcoming series of the BBC sci-fi drama featuring a number of episodes that extend over more than one installment.
Stephen Fry And Lenny Henry To Appear In Upcoming Doctor Who Series 12
With the TARDIS hurtling full throttle on its way back to BBC One, it is only right that two TV legends will be making their Doctor Who debut.
TV icons Stephen Fry and Sir Lenny Henry CBE will both appear in the series opener when the TARDIS lands once more, with Jodie Whittaker reprising her role as the Thirteenth Doctor.
